In plain language

Methods that find patterns in data without a supplied answer label for each example. [1]

Limits & distinctions

Unsupervised does not mean free of human choices. The selected data and definition of similarity shape the groups. [2]

A fuller explanation

Clustering is one example: it groups items by a chosen measure of similarity. Imagine grouping songs by their sound without giving the program genre labels first. [2]
